Common Overtime Violations by Employers

When you’re putting in the hard yards, it’s crucial to know your rights around overtime pay. Knowing the tricks some employers might pull can save you from underpayment. Here’s the lowdown on common ways employers might shortchange employees on overtime:

Unpaid Overtime for Hourly Workers

Ever felt like that extra hour was for nothing? A big no-no is when hourly workers aren’t getting paid properly for grinding beyond the usual 40 hours a week. By law, those extra hours should earn you 1.5 times your normal hourly rate. If that’s not happening, someone’s breaking the rules big time.

Misclassification of Employees as Exempt

Some bosses try the old “you’re exempt” trick to dodge overtime pay when you’re actually eligible. This misclassification can cheat you out of cash for hours exceeding the regular workweek. Employers have to get your job title and duties right to follow labor laws.

Off-the-Clock Work That Should Be Paid

Ever clocked out but still doing tasks for your boss? Many companies sneak past paying for off-the-clock work. Any job you do, whether it’s before, after, or outside of your shift, should be paid. You’ve got the right to get paid for every minute worked, be it from the office or your couch.

Failure to Pay Overtime for Remote and Gig Workers

Remote and gig work has become the norm, but that doesn’t mean pay rules go out the window. Any hours you clock working from your bedroom or coffee shop need to be on record, and any overtime should be paid properly. Skipping out on rightful overtime pay for remote or gig workers? That’s illegal and can lead to some hefty penalties.

Signs That Your Employer May Be Violating the Law

  1. Long Hours, Low Pay: If you’re clocking over 40 hours in a week without the extra pay, it’s time to consider if the law’s on your side.

  2. Covert Clocking: Feeling the nudge to work off-the-clock or during your oh-so-necessary coffee break? Yep, that’s not cool—or legal.

  3. Timesheet Tinkering: If your hours magically disappear from timesheets or your overtime gets erased, you’ve got something fishy going on.

How to Gather Evidence for Your Case

  1. Track Your Time: Keep a log of when you work, including every start, end, and those sneaky off-the-clock hours.

  2. Keep Receipts (Well, Emails): Hold onto any communication about your hours and pay—every email, note, or memo is a potential piece of your puzzle.

  3. Pay Stubs Tell All: Your stubs are your friends here. They can highlight any mismatch between what you worked and what you got paid.

How Long Do I Have to File an Overtime Claim?

The time to file is two years from when your overtime pay should have landed in your pocket. But if your employer has been extra sneaky, maybe stretching the truth, you might get an extra year—taking it to three. If you get a whiff of something fishy, don’t dilly-dally; get legal advice sooner rather than later to know your filing deadlines.

What Compensation Can I Receive for Overtime Violations?

If your claim against your boss sticks, there’s some cash flow coming your way. You could collect your unpaid overtime, maybe even get double that amount, plus attorney’s fees and court costs. The payout can vary based on how your employer dropped the ball and how badly they went against the rules.
